The Scientific Principles Behind Temperature and Bed Bug Elimination

Grasping the relationship between temperature and bed bug mortality is key to grasping the efficacy of heat treatment. Bed bugs, formally classified as Cimex lectularius, are affected by temperature extremes. Studies show that contact with temperatures above 118°F (48°C) for a continuous stretch of time can effectively kill bed bugs in each developmental phase, including eggs. On the other hand, temperatures below 50°F (10°C) can increase their longevity, enabling them to reach a dormant state.

The deadly impact of heat on bed bugs stems from its effect on their physiological functions. Extreme temperatures interfere with cellular functions and cause dehydration, finally causing mortality. Additionally, heat treatment penetrates various materials, guaranteeing that concealed infestations are eliminated. The success of this technique is rooted in its capacity to maintain consistent heat levels across affected areas, eradicating the insects without relying on chemical treatments, establishing it as a top selection for numerous pest control specialists.

Bed Bug Life Cycle

The success rate of heat treatment against bed bugs is closely linked to their life cycle. Bed bugs pass through several stages: egg, nymph, and adult. Eggs are notably fragile, as they cannot withstand high temperatures. Once hatched, nymphs and adults are also susceptible; however, they can endure lower temperatures for limited timeframes. Heat treatment elevates the temperature to thresholds fatal for all life stages, interrupting their life cycle. At 118°F (48°C), bed bugs begin to die within 90 minutes, while temperatures above 122°F (50°C) can eradicate them within minutes. This thorough approach ensures that not only adult bed bugs are eliminated, but also their eggs and nymphs, making heat treatment a remarkably efficient method for full eradication.

Chemical Resistance Constraints

A growing number of pest control professionals are increasingly concerned about the increasing chemical resistance of bed bugs. Conventional insecticides, once effective, are continually failing due to resistance mechanisms in bed bug populations. These bugs can build up resistance through genetic mutations, making it difficult for chemical treatments to eradicate infestations entirely. As a result, relying solely on chemicals can result in prolonged infestations and higher costs for homeowners. In contrast, heat treatment avoids this issue by targeting bed bugs with high temperatures that they cannot withstand. At temperatures above 120°F, bed bugs, including eggs and nymphs, are swiftly eliminated within minutes. This method not only ensures complete extermination but also removes the risk of resistance, making heat treatment a proven solution for bed bug infestations.

Duration Of Treatment Process

How much time does a bed bug heat treatment generally require? Typically, the treatment process may last between six and eight hours, based on the extent of the affected area and the degree of the infestation. Over this duration, temperatures between 120°F and 140°F are carefully maintained to achieve thorough elimination of bed bugs across all life stages. Homeowners should be prepared for the entire space to heat up, which may require removing sensitive items beforehand. After the treatment, a cooling-down period will follow, allowing the environment to return to a safe temperature. Occupants must exit the premises as advised to maintain the best possible results and ensure safety for the duration of the treatment.

Key Steps to Get Ready for Heat Treatment

Getting ready for bed bug heat treatment requires careful planning to secure safety and effectiveness. Property owners should begin by taking items out of the treatment area, including clothing, linens, and personal belongings, to protect items and guarantee comprehensive heat distribution. It is vital to launder and dry these items on elevated heat settings to remove any lurking bed bugs.

Furthermore, furniture needs to be shifted away from walls to allow heat to circulate freely. Furthermore, delicate electronics, plants, and perishable items should be transferred to prevent exposure to elevated temperatures. Pets need to be brought to a secure environment throughout the treatment, as they may be negatively impacted.

Ultimately, consulting with the pest control professional is crucial for understanding specific instructions tailored to the situation. Following these steps will help maximize the effectiveness of the heat treatment process, guaranteeing a bed bug-free home.
